微信小程序的崛起与重要性
在移动互联网时代,小程序作为一种无需下载安装即可使用的应用形式,因其便捷性、易用性和跨平台特性,受到了广大用户的喜爱。微信小程序更是凭借其庞大的用户基础,成为了小程序开发的热门选择。今天,我们就来揭开微信小程序开发的神秘面纱,带你轻松上手,高效搭建你的专属应用。
微信小程序开发环境搭建
1. 系统要求
首先,你需要确保你的开发环境满足微信小程序的开发要求。通常,这包括操作系统(如Windows、macOS、Linux)、编程语言支持(如JavaScript、WXML、WXSS)等。
2. 开发工具安装
微信官方推荐使用微信开发者工具进行开发。这款工具集成了代码编辑、调试、预览等功能,大大提高了开发效率。
# 安装微信开发者工具
wget https://dldir1.qq.com/wechattools/WeChatDevToolsSetup_vxxx.dmg -O WeChatDevToolsSetup.dmg
3. 账号注册与认证
在微信公众平台上注册一个开发者账号,并进行认证。这是你进行微信小程序开发的必要前提。
微信小程序系统架构
微信小程序系统架构主要包括前端、后端和服务端三部分。
1. 前端
前端负责用户界面的展示和交互。主要技术包括:
- WXML(微信标记语言):类似于HTML,用于构建页面结构。
- WXSS(微信样式表):类似于CSS,用于定义页面样式。
- JavaScript:用于实现页面的交互逻辑。
2. 后端
后端主要负责数据处理和业务逻辑的实现。你可以选择多种后端技术,如Node.js、PHP、Python等。
3. 服务端
服务端是连接前端和后端的桥梁,主要负责API的封装和数据的交互。微信小程序提供了一套丰富的API,方便开发者进行服务端开发。
微信小程序开发流程
1. 需求分析
在开始开发之前,你需要对项目需求进行详细的分析,明确功能、界面和性能等方面的要求。
2. 设计界面
根据需求分析的结果,设计小程序的界面。可以使用原型设计工具,如Axure、Sketch等。
3. 编写代码
使用微信开发者工具,按照设计稿编写WXML、WXSS和JavaScript代码。
4. 调试与优化
在开发过程中,不断进行调试和优化,确保小程序的性能和稳定性。
5. 部署上线
完成开发后,将小程序提交到微信公众平台上进行审核,审核通过后即可上线。
高效搭建你的专属应用
1. 熟悉微信小程序开发文档
微信官方提供了详细的开发文档,涵盖了各个方面的技术细节。熟悉这些文档,有助于你快速上手。
2. 参考优秀案例
学习其他开发者的优秀案例,了解他们的设计思路和开发技巧。
3. 持续学习
小程序技术不断更新,保持学习的热情,跟上技术发展的步伐。
4. 沟通与交流
加入微信小程序开发社区,与其他开发者交流心得,共同进步。
通过以上全攻略,相信你已经对微信小程序开发有了更深入的了解。现在,就让我们拿起手中的工具,开始你的小程序开发之旅吧!
